The TOEFL Listening section evaluates your ability to understand spoken English in academic contexts, often featuring dialogues between students and faculty. This section can be challenging, as it requires you to capture essential details, grasp the main ideas, and interpret the context of the conversation.
In this practice set, we’ll focus on a conversation about 'Confirming Application Deadlines for Honours Programmes.' Working with realistic dialogues like this one can enhance your listening skills and prepare you for the kinds of discussions you may encounter on the exam.
While listening, pay close attention to specific details, such as application deadlines and requirements, as well as the subtleties in the speakers' tones and expressions. Listening Instructions
- You can listen to each conversation and lecture only once.
- You have approximately 8 minutes to listen to the conversation/lecture and respond to the questions.
- Each question generally carries one point unless otherwise specified in the instructions, which will explicitly state the assigned points for specific questions.
- After listening to the Conversation, respond to questions related to the topic based on explicit or implicit statements made by the speakers.
- Feel free to make notes as you listen. You can refer to your notes to aid in answering the questions.
- We recommend practicing note-taking with a pen and paper, similar to what you'll do during the TOEFL Exam.

Transcript of the Audio Conversation on Confirming Application Deadlines for Honours Programmes
James: Hi, Tom! I was hoping to catch you for a moment. I need to confirm the application deadlines for the honours programmes.
Tom: Sure, James! I’ve been looking into that myself. Which programme are you interested in?
James: I’m thinking about the honours programme in psychology. I heard it’s quite competitive, and I want to make sure I don’t miss the deadline.
Tom: Good choice! I believe the application deadline is the 15th of March. But I’d recommend checking the university’s website just to be certain. They sometimes update the dates.
James: Right, I’ll do that. I remember last year they extended the deadline for some programmes. Do you think they might do that again?
Tom: It’s possible, but I wouldn’t count on it. It’s always better to prepare as if the deadline is fixed. Have you started working on your application yet?
James: I’ve begun drafting my personal statement, but I’m still gathering my recommendation letters. I want to ask Professor Smith, but I’m a bit nervous about it.
Tom: I understand. It can be daunting, but professors are usually quite supportive. Just explain your interest in the programme and why you think they’d be a good fit for your recommendation.
James: That’s true. I’ll try to approach him this week. By the way, do you know if there are any specific requirements for the honours programme?
Tom: Yes, aside from the application form and personal statement, they usually require a minimum GPA and some extracurricular involvement. It’s best to check the details on the website, though.
James: Thanks for the heads-up, Tom! I’ll make sure to review everything carefully. I really appreciate your help.
Tom: No problem at all! Good luck with your application, and let me know if you need any more assistance.

Answers and Explanations of the Conversation on Confirming Application Deadlines for Honours Programmes
1. Answer: B. To confirm the application deadlines for the honours programmes.
Explanation: The main focus of the conversation is James seeking confirmation about the application deadlines for the honours programmes, specifically in psychology. The other options, such as discussing benefits, asking for help with the personal statement, or inquiring about university life, are not the primary purpose of their discussion.
2. Answer: B. 15th of March.
Explanation: Tom clearly states that the application deadline for the honours programme in psychology is the 15th of March. The other options, such as the 1st of March, 30th of March, and 1st of April, are incorrect as they were not mentioned in the conversation.
3. Answer: B. Students should assume the deadline will not change and plan accordingly.
Explanation: Tom advises James to prepare as if the deadline is fixed, meaning he should act as though the date will not be extended. This approach encourages students to be proactive and not rely on potential changes, making options a, c, and d incorrect.
4. Answer: B. Nervous and apprehensive.
Explanation: James expresses that he is a bit nervous about asking Professor Smith for a recommendation, indicating his apprehension. The other options, such as feeling confident, indifferent, or excited, do not accurately reflect his feelings as conveyed in the conversation.
5. Answer: B. A minimum GPA and some extracurricular involvement.
Explanation: Tom mentions that, in addition to the application form and personal statement, the honours program typically requires a minimum GPA and some extracurricular involvement. The other options, such as only needing the application form and personal statement, a personal interview and portfolio, or no specific requirements, are incorrect as they do not align with what was discussed.
